Output 66f5e3512ea545bc60b7b6b713c2d308206eaee497eec4c5414263c6777089e6:1

value
4640
script pubkey
OP_0 OP_PUSHBYTES_20 127809bc63a0a3e7da1d5f4a7fcfd7860c82d36f
address
tb1qzfuqn0rr5z370ksata98ln7hscxg95m0369rzw
transaction
66f5e3512ea545bc60b7b6b713c2d308206eaee497eec4c5414263c6777089e6